#43
@tthamm, do you have the communication working via read test? The device documentation is very clear, you only have to convert addresses from hex to decimal for testing.

Try reading Active import with these settings:
- Function: Holding register (#3)
- Address: 20480
- Data type: uint64
- Read swap: Word
The read value is in 0.01KWh. If the value is incorrect then try using different read swap modes.

Hi,

When using a profile and reading blocs of parameters, "read_count" refers to number of 16bit modbus registers or number of registers defined on "datatype"?

I mean if I use something like this:

{"name": "Input_Register_1",
"bus_datatype": "float32",
"type": "inputregister",
"datatype": "float32",
"address": 4,
"read_offset": 0,
"read_count": 4,
"writable": 0,
"value_delta": 1,
"value_multiplier": 1,
"units": "%"
},
{"name": "Input_Register_2",
"bus_datatype": "float32",
"type": "inputregister",
"datatype": "float32",
"address": 4,
"read_offset": 2,
"read_count": 4,
"writable": 0,
"value_delta": 1,
"value_multiplier": 1,
"units": "%"
}


Is this reading input register 4 as 32bit float and register 6 as 32bit float using a single modbus read command? (count is 4 because we're reading registers 4,5,6 and 7)

Or should I define read_count as 2 because I'm reading 2 32bit registers?

Thanks.
Reply
#51
Size is always 1 register (16 bits) no matter what the data type is. The system will read the required number of registers based on the data type chosen.

Block read is needed for certain devices that don't allow reading registers directly but only via a large block read. Block read can be useful in large projects since it speeds things up but usually values can be simply read one by one.

#55
You can use Windows calculator for bitmasks. Switch to "Programmer" mode then switch keypad to "Bit toggling" mode. Switch required bits from 0 to 1. The HEX or DEC value will be your bitmask. For HEX you need to add 0x before the number in the profile (for example F becomes 0xF and so on).
